    Read each sentence carefully to find out whether there

    is any grammatical or idiomatic error in it. The error, if any, will be in one part of the sentence marked (a), (b), (c) or (d). Choose the option corresponding to that part. If the sentence is correct as it is, choose “No error (e)” as your answer. Ignore errors of punctuation, if any. The success of any large-scale reform depends (a) upon not only careful planning (b) but also effective execution and consistent monitoring (c) at every stage of implementation (d). No error (e)

    Solution

    This question tests the correct placement of correlative conjunctions (not only … but also). According to grammar rules, “not only” should be placed immediately before the first element it modifies. In this sentence, “not only” is incorrectly placed after the preposition “upon.”  The correct structure would be “depends not only on careful planning but also on effective execution…” Hence, part (b) is grammatically incorrect.
